Output d32438fcf8a7e28fd959e2d2dea7e4471223fdf520fd47ffd6501b625b7f685d:63

value
89644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828141d998fc88d84eff79ee9a7491c76898ea69 OP_EQUAL
address
3Db4cRxzVKe1MbyCTBgSpHiPHC8nt1JxhY
transaction
d32438fcf8a7e28fd959e2d2dea7e4471223fdf520fd47ffd6501b625b7f685d